Dense dislocation arrays embedded in grain boundaries for high-performance bulk thermoelectrics

TL;DR: A dramatic improvement of efficiency is shown in bismuth telluride samples by quickly squeezing out excess liquid during compaction, which presents an attractive path forward for thermoelectrics.
Journal ArticleDOI

Effects of doping on transport properties in Cu-Bi-Se-based thermoelectric materials

TL;DR: A doping strategy is demonstrated that provides a simultaneous control for enhanced electronic transport properties by the optimization of carrier concentration and exceptionally low lattice thermal conductivity by the formation of point defects.
